Sonny Kahn pays $28M for oceanfront estate in Manalapan
Developer Sonny Kahn, a founding partner at Miami-based Crescent Heights, and his wife, Suzanne, paid $28 million for an oceanfront estate in Manalapan. The Kahns acquired the 1.6-acre property at 1200 South Ocean Boulevard about a month after selling their waterfront Miami Beach estate to developer Todd Michael Glaser and his partner, the Posner Group. They sold the 2.3-acre home at 5940 North Bay Road for $105 million. Property records show an LLC managed by investment firm executive Nobel Gulati and his wife, Ruchi, sold the Manalapan property to Kahn and his wife, Suzanne Passi Kahn.
